What is an Ethernet Cable?

An Ethernet cable is a type of network cable used to connect devices to a wired network. It consists of eight individual wires twisted together in pairs and terminated with an RJ45 connector. This connector is a small, plastic plug with eight pins that allows the cable to be plugged into network ports on devices like computers, routers, and switches.

Types of Ethernet Cables

There are several types of Ethernet cables, each with different specifications and capabilities:

  • Category 5 (Cat5): The most basic type of Ethernet cable, suitable for speeds up to 100 Mbps and distances of up to 100 meters.
  • Category 5 enhanced (Cat5e): An improved version of Cat5, offering speeds up to 1 Gbps and distances of up to 100 meters.
  • Category 6 (Cat6): Supports speeds up to 10 Gbps and distances of up to 55 meters.
  • Category 6 augmented (Cat6a): An enhanced version of Cat6, supporting speeds up to 10 Gbps over distances of up to 100 meters.
  • Category 7 (Cat7): The latest and fastest type of Ethernet cable, capable of speeds up to 100 Gbps over short distances.

Why Use an Ethernet Cable?

Ethernet cables offer several advantages over wireless connections:

  • Higher Speed and Stability: Wired Ethernet connections provide significantly higher speeds and more stable connections than wireless networks, which can be affected by interference and signal strength.
  • Lower Latency: Ethernet cables have lower latency than wireless connections, making them ideal for online gaming and other applications that require real-time responses.
  • Security: Wired Ethernet connections are more secure than wireless networks, as they are not susceptible to eavesdropping or interference.
  • Reliability: Ethernet cables are less prone to signal dropouts and interruptions than wireless connections, ensuring a reliable and consistent connection.

How to Install an Ethernet Cable

Installing an Ethernet cable is a straightforward process that can be completed in a few simple steps:

  1. Plan the Cable Route: Determine the path the cable will take from the source device to the destination.
  2. Cut the Cable to Length: Cut the Ethernet cable to the appropriate length using a cable cutter.
  3. Terminate the Cables: Crimp RJ45 connectors onto the ends of the Ethernet cable using a crimping tool.
  4. Test the Cable: Use a cable tester to verify that the Ethernet cable is functioning correctly.
  5. Connect the Devices: Plug the Ethernet cables into the network ports on the devices you want to connect.
